35, i want new not used. Is cro-mo worth it?

I'd say yes, since you have very manly tires. But then the rest of the shafts are probably stock. If you don't mind dropping the money, put a fresh set of chromo in the axle. Dave will tell you after some years the ears in the yokes of the stock shafts stretched on his. Not only is the material stronger, there's much more material on the yokes, at least on the Yukons I have.

If you're just buying one piece and are willing to replace as you break them, still probably good buying 1 chromo piece at a time, it's not much more than new stock.
